So, 'Go LazyTown' is this quirky 1996 musical that takes us to Latibær, where the townsfolk are really into their sedentary lifestyle—think sweets and endless TV time. The whole vibe is super colorful and almost cartoonish, which contrasts nicely with the underlying message about health and activity. The Sports-Elf shows up to shake things up, bringing a dose of energy that feels both whimsical and slightly surreal. The practical effects used in the musical numbers add a unique charm, and the performances are quite spirited, if not a bit over-the-top. It’s a fascinating and offbeat reflection on society's relationship with laziness and health, wrapped in a bright, catchy package that feels almost nostalgic.
